Supply Chain Coordinator
Job Summary
This position provides broad exposure to enterprise supply chain operations and systems within a large multi-sector organization based in Calgary AB with occasional travel to project sites as required.
What You Will Be Working On
Administrative & Process Support
- Maintain and update supply chain documentation forms checklists and procedures on internal SharePoint sites.
- Assist in compiling organizing and distributing reports and presentations for various audiences including management and project teams.
- Support the implementation and communication of supply chain policies procedures best practices and resources.
- Coordinate meeting logistics prepare agendas record minutes and track action items for supply chain-related meetings.
- Assist with document control and ensure compliance with company standards.
Vendor & Data Management
- Support vendor master data updates and ensure accuracy in company databases.
- Assist in the administration of RFQ RFP and RFI processes including tracking submissions and maintaining contact lists.
- Help compile and distribute vendor communications and maintain preferred vendor information on the company intranet.
- Track proposals submissions and feedback supporting the Lead in vendor relationship management.
Reporting & Analytics
- Compile and analyze spend data vendor utilization and market trends to support category management and strategic sourcing initiatives.
- Utilize approved digital and AI-enabled tools to support data analysis reporting preparation and insight generation for supply chain initiatives.
- Prepare regular KPI reports and dashboards for the supply chain team.
- Assist in the preparation of research and competitive analysis for strategic and annual forecasts.
Cross-Functional Collaboration
- Work closely with business units stakeholders and the broader supply chain team to move key priorities forward.
- Support the Manager in coordinating with Finance Operations Digital Services and other departments.
